Evangel Christian football won the 8-man state championship two years ago. Last fall, they lost in the semifinals. Now the Lightning are ready to strike back
The Evangel Christian football team stands two years removed from an 8-man state championship. Last year, they lost in the semifinals. And that’s only made the Lightning hungrier going into next season under fourth-year head coach Darius Dixon.
“The year before, with us being in the state championship and of course winning,” Tobiyas McLemore, a senior wide receiver and defensive back said, “then we lose in the game right before it, it definitely hurt. Some people went down, but that’s no excuse. We’re going to come back and do what we’re supposed to do this year.”
The Lightning will have to replace several players, which Dixon said is a big deal in eight-man football. “I believe last year we lost a total of like three seniors that helped out on the field,” he said. “But we brought some guys in, and some guys are stepping up on the field as well. Had a lot of young guys on the field last year, so expecting some more big things out of them.”
